January had Asheboro Ford change the entire fuel system because of a CP4 pump failure. For some reason they changed the air filter too. When replacing the air filter, they put the hose clamp in a position where the bolt from the clamp was under the water hose which eventually punctured through the hose. I was lucky enough to have many cases of drinking water and nursed it to the local Ford dealer. Left unchecked, it would have ruined the engine or put me into slow motion mode.
